Factors to Consider When Choosing an OCD Therapist in Oklahoma City
Finding OCD therapists in Oklahoma City starts with looking for the right specialty training. OCD therapy often focuses on intrusive thoughts, obsessions, compulsions, avoidance, and anxiety that can come with these experiences. Exposure and response prevention, often called ERP, is one therapy approach some clinicians may use when supporting people with OCD, and a qualified mental health professional can help determine what approach may be appropriate. Since not all therapists are trained in ERP, review each therapist’s bio for OCD experience, ERP training, and related approaches like cognitive behavioral therapy or acceptance and commitment therapy.
Oklahoma City has many mental health care options, which can make it harder to compare therapists quickly. As you narrow your search, look beyond a therapist’s specialty list and check whether they describe specific ERP training, how they structure OCD therapy, and what types of concerns they work with most often. You can also compare appointment availability, virtual or in-person session options, and whether a free phone consultation is offered. Provider bios can help you understand communication style, approach, and whether their experience matches what you want from counseling for obsessive compulsive disorder.
